GRILLED SHRIMP SKEWERS WITH SOY SAUCE, FRESH GINGER AND TOASTED SESAME SEEDS
Provided by Bobby Flay
Categories appetizer
Time 1h19m
Yield 4 to 6 servings
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Soak 4-inch wooden skewers in cold water for 1 hour. Thread 1 shrimp onto each skewer so that the shrimp lie flat.
- Whisk together the soy, garlic, ginger, sesame oil, white wine vinegar, lime juice and peanut oil together in a small bowl. Place shrimp skewers onto a plate and drizzle with peanut oil to lightly coat. Season with salt and pepper.
- Heat grill. Grill shrimp 2 minutes per side or until just cooked through. Place shrimp on a platter, drizzle with vinaigrette and sprinkle with sesame seeds.

SKEWERED SESAME SHRIMP
Skewered shrimp is easy to turn during cooking; you can also saute shrimp on their own. These shrimp are perfect with buttered rice or noodles and sauteed greens. Regular or sugar snap peas would also be a good choice.
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Appetizers Finger Food Recipes
Time 25m
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Thread 3 shrimp onto each of eight 6-inch bamboo skewers. Combine soy sauce and vinegar in a shallow dish, and put sesame seeds on a plate. Dip each skewer of shrimp into the soy-vinegar mixture, and then dip both sides in the sesame seeds.
- In a large skillet, heat oil over medium-high heat. Add skewered shrimp, and cook until shrimp are opaque, about 3 minutes on each side. Transfer skewers to a plate. Pour the remaining soy-vinegar mixture into the hot pan, and cook, stirring, until slightly thickened, about 15 seconds. Drizzle sauce over shrimp, and serve warm or at room temperature.

GRILLED SHRIMP KABOBS | KATHLEEN'S CRAVINGS
From kathleenscravings.com
Cuisine AmericanCategory GrillingServings 4Total Time 20 mins
- Marinate Shrimp – In a medium/large bowl, mix together the shrimp marinade ingredients (olive oil, lemon juice and zest, and spices). Add the shrimp to the bowl and toss to combine. Allow to marinate for at least 20 minutes (perfect amount of time to preheat the grill) or up to one hour. If using wooden skewers, soak them in water for 10-30 minutes before threading with the shrimp.
- Preheat Grill – Preheat the grill to medium-high heat (450-500 degrees F) for direct grilling (ie. the shrimp will go directly over the flame).
- Skewer Shrimp – While the grill preheats, skewer the shrimp on 3-4 skewers and place on a plate. The excess marinade needs to be discarded.
- Grill – Grease your grill grates, if desired, with vegetable oil on a paper towel using grilling tongs. Then add the marinated shrimp skewers to the grill. Close the grill and grill each side for 2-3 minutes (about 5 minutes total) until fully cooked. Shrimp are cooked when they are pink and opaque – be careful not to overcook. If you’d like, you can toss extra lemon slices on the grill for just a minute or two to get a nice char and serve with the shrimp.
